| Comments |
Jelšingrad — the name itself is a Yugoslav-era compound of "Jelša" (alder tree) and "grad" (city) — was a major machine-building and steel foundry complex in Banja Luka, established in the socialist industrialization drives of postwar Yugoslavia. Factory-issued meal coupons of this type were a routine feature of large Yugoslav industrial enterprises, functioning as internal scrip redeemable only at the plant canteen. They circulated entirely outside the formal monetary system and were never intended to survive.
That most did not is precisely why even ordinary surviving examples from smaller regional works like Jelšingrad attract collector interest today.
